Features
The Charles Daly 101 is a reliable and versatile 20 Gauge shotgun perfect for various shooting applications. This break-open action single-shot features a durable 26-inch stainless steel barrel with a Flat Dark Earth Cerakote finish. With a 3-inch chamber and a Beretta Benelli Mobil choke configuration, it offers adaptability, and it comes with an XX-Full choke included. Designed for right-handed shooters, this full-size shotgun has an overall length of 41.75 inches and weighs just 5 lbs. 1 The stainless steel receiver also features a matching Flat Dark Earth Cerakote finish. It's equipped with a simple and effective brass bead front sight, a comfortable synthetic stock with a TrueTimber Prairie finish, and a convenient thumb safety. The drop measures 1.25 inches at the comb and 2.38 inches at the heel. Experience the quality and straightforward functionality of the Charles Daly 101 shotgun.
